CrypTen
latest
CrypTen Documentation
Launch on AWS
Package Reference
crypten.CrypTensor
crypten.MPCTensor
crypten.nn
CrypTen
Docs
»
Index
Edit on GitHub
Index
A
|
B
|
C
|
D
|
E
|
F
|
G
|
I
|
L
|
M
|
N
|
P
|
R
|
S
|
T
|
U
|
V
|
W
|
Z
A
abs() (crypten.mpc.mpc.MPCTensor method)
adaptive_avg_pool2d()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
adaptive_max_pool2d()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Add (class in crypten.nn.module)
add() (crypten.cryptensor.CrypTensor method)
add_() (crypten.cryptensor.CrypTensor method)
argmax()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
argmin()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
arithmetic() (crypten.mpc.mpc.MPCTensor method)
avg_pool2d() (crypten.cryptensor.CrypTensor method)
AvgPool2d (class in crypten.nn.module)
B
backward() (crypten.cryptensor.CrypTensor method)
batchnorm() (crypten.cryptensor.CrypTensor method)
BatchNorm1d (class in crypten.nn.module)
BatchNorm2d (class in crypten.nn.module)
BatchNorm3d (class in crypten.nn.module)
BCELoss (class in crypten.nn.loss)
BCEWithLogitsLoss (class in crypten.nn.loss)
bernoulli() (crypten.mpc.mpc.MPCTensor method)
binary() (crypten.mpc.mpc.MPCTensor method)
C
cat() (crypten.mpc.mpc.MPCTensor static method)
clone()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Concat (class in crypten.nn.module)
ConfigManager (class in crypten.mpc.mpc)
Constant (class in crypten.nn.module)
ConstantPad1d (class in crypten.nn.module)
,
[1]
ConstantPad2d (class in crypten.nn.module)
ConstantPad3d (class in crypten.nn.module)
Container (class in crypten.nn.module)
Conv2d (class in crypten.nn.module)
conv2d() (crypten.cryptensor.CrypTensor method)
copy_()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
cos()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
cossin() (crypten.mpc.mpc.MPCTensor method)
cpu() (crypten.mpc.mpc.MPCTensor method)
CrossEntropyLoss (class in crypten.nn.loss)
crypten (module)
crypten.cryptensor (module)
crypten.mpc.mpc (module)
crypten.nn (module)
crypten.nn.loss (module)
CrypTensor (class in crypten.cryptensor)
CrypTensorMetaclass (class in crypten.cryptensor)
cuda() (crypten.mpc.mpc.MPCTensor method)
cumsum() (crypten.cryptensor.CrypTensor method)
D
decrypt() (crypten.nn.module.Module method)
detach() (crypten.cryptensor.CrypTensor method)
detach_() (crypten.cryptensor.CrypTensor method)
device() (crypten.mpc.mpc.MPCTensor property)
div()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
div_()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
dot() (crypten.cryptensor.CrypTensor method)
Dropout (class in crypten.nn.module)
dropout()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Dropout2d (class in crypten.nn.module)
dropout2d()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Dropout3d (class in crypten.nn.module)
dropout3d()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
DropoutNd (class in crypten.nn.module)
E
enable_grad() (crypten.cryptensor.CrypTensor static method)
encoder() (crypten.mpc.mpc.MPCTensor property)
encrypt() (crypten.nn.module.Module method)
eq()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
eval() (crypten.nn.module.Module method)
exp()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
expand() (crypten.cryptensor.CrypTensor method)
F
Flatten (class in crypten.nn.module)
flatten() (crypten.cryptensor.CrypTensor method)
flip() (crypten.cryptensor.CrypTensor method)
forward() (crypten.nn.loss.BCELoss method)
(crypten.nn.loss.BCEWithLogitsLoss method)
(crypten.nn.loss.CrossEntropyLoss method)
(crypten.nn.loss.L1Loss method)
(crypten.nn.loss.MSELoss method)
(crypten.nn.module.Add method)
(crypten.nn.module.AvgPool2d method)
(crypten.nn.module.BatchNorm1d method)
(crypten.nn.module.BatchNorm2d method)
(crypten.nn.module.BatchNorm3d method)
(crypten.nn.module.Concat method)
(crypten.nn.module.Constant method)
(crypten.nn.module.ConstantPad1d method)
,
[1]
(crypten.nn.module.ConstantPad2d method)
(crypten.nn.module.ConstantPad3d method)
(crypten.nn.module.Conv2d method)
(crypten.nn.module.Dropout method)
(crypten.nn.module.Dropout2d method)
(crypten.nn.module.Dropout3d method)
(crypten.nn.module.DropoutNd method)
(crypten.nn.module.Flatten method)
(crypten.nn.module.Gather method)
(crypten.nn.module.GlobalAveragePool method)
(crypten.nn.module.Graph method)
(crypten.nn.module.Linear method)
(crypten.nn.module.LogSoftmax method)
(crypten.nn.module.MaxPool2d method)
(crypten.nn.module.Module method)
(crypten.nn.module.Reshape method)
(crypten.nn.module.Shape method)
(crypten.nn.module.Softmax method)
(crypten.nn.module.Squeeze method)
(crypten.nn.module.Sub method)
(crypten.nn.module.Unsqueeze method)
from_pytorch() (in module crypten.nn)
G
Gather (class in crypten.nn.module)
gather() (crypten.cryptensor.CrypTensor method)
ge()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
ger() (crypten.cryptensor.CrypTensor method)
get_plain_text()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
get_rank() (in module crypten.communicator.Communicator)
get_world_size() (in module crypten.communicator.Communicator)
GlobalAveragePool (class in crypten.nn.module)
Graph (class in crypten.nn.module)
gt()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
I
index_add()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
index_add_()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
index_select() (crypten.cryptensor.CrypTensor method)
is_cuda() (crypten.mpc.mpc.MPCTensor property)
L
L1Loss (class in crypten.nn.loss)
le()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Linear (class in crypten.nn.module)
load() (in module crypten)
log()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
log_softmax()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
LogSoftmax (class in crypten.nn.module)
lt()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
M
matmul() (crypten.cryptensor.CrypTensor method)
max()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
max_pool2d()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
MaxPool2d (class in crypten.nn.module)
mean() (crypten.cryptensor.CrypTensor method)
min()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Module (class in crypten.nn.module)
modules() (crypten.nn.module.Module method)
MPCConfig (class in crypten.mpc.mpc)
MPCTensor (class in crypten.mpc.mpc)
MSELoss (class in crypten.nn.loss)
mul() (crypten.cryptensor.CrypTensor method)
mul_() (crypten.cryptensor.CrypTensor method)
N
named_modules() (crypten.nn.module.Module method)
named_parameters() (crypten.nn.module.Module method)
narrow() (crypten.cryptensor.CrypTensor method)
ne()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
neg() (crypten.cryptensor.CrypTensor method)
neg_() (crypten.cryptensor.CrypTensor method)
new() (crypten.cryptensor.CrypTensor static method)
(crypten.mpc.mpc.MPCTensor static method)
no_grad() (crypten.cryptensor.CrypTensor static method)
norm()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
P
pad()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
polynomial() (crypten.mpc.mpc.MPCTensor method)
pos_pow() (crypten.mpc.mpc.MPCTensor method)
pow() (crypten.mpc.mpc.MPCTensor method)
pow_() (crypten.mpc.mpc.MPCTensor method)
R
rand() (crypten.mpc.mpc.MPCTensor static method)
randn() (crypten.mpc.mpc.MPCTensor static method)
reciprocal()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
relu()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
repeat() (crypten.cryptensor.CrypTensor method)
Reshape (class in crypten.nn.module)
reshape() (crypten.cryptensor.CrypTensor method)
reveal() (crypten.mpc.mpc.MPCTensor method)
roll() (crypten.cryptensor.CrypTensor method)
run_multiprocess() (in module crypten.mpc.context)
S
save() (in module crypten)
scatter() (crypten.mpc.mpc.MPCTensor method)
scatter_() (crypten.mpc.mpc.MPCTensor method)
scatter_add()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
scatter_add_()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Sequential (class in crypten.nn.module)
set()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
set_grad_enabled() (crypten.cryptensor.CrypTensor static method)
shallow_copy()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Shape (class in crypten.nn.module)
share() (crypten.mpc.mpc.MPCTensor property)
sigmoid()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
sign() (crypten.mpc.mpc.MPCTensor method)
sin()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Softmax (class in crypten.nn.module)
softmax()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
sqrt()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
square() (crypten.cryptensor.CrypTensor method)
Squeeze (class in crypten.nn.module)
squeeze() (crypten.cryptensor.CrypTensor method)
stack() (crypten.mpc.mpc.MPCTensor static method)
Sub (class in crypten.nn.module)
sub() (crypten.cryptensor.CrypTensor method)
sub_() (crypten.cryptensor.CrypTensor method)
sum() (crypten.cryptensor.CrypTensor method)
T
t() (crypten.cryptensor.CrypTensor method)
take() (crypten.cryptensor.CrypTensor method)
tanh()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
to() (crypten.mpc.mpc.MPCTensor method)
trace() (crypten.cryptensor.CrypTensor method)
train() (crypten.nn.module.Module method)
transpose() (crypten.cryptensor.CrypTensor method)
U
unfold() (crypten.cryptensor.CrypTensor method)
Unsqueeze (class in crypten.nn.module)
unsqueeze() (crypten.cryptensor.CrypTensor method)
update_parameters() (crypten.nn.module.Module method)
V
var() (crypten.cryptensor.CrypTensor method)
view() (crypten.cryptensor.CrypTensor method)
W
weighted_index() (crypten.mpc.mpc.MPCTensor method)
weighted_sample() (crypten.mpc.mpc.MPCTensor method)
where() (crypten.cryptensor.CrypTensor method)
(crypten.mpc.mpc.MPCTensor method)
Z
zero_grad() (crypten.nn.module.Module method)
Read the Docs
v: latest
Versions
latest
stable
Downloads
On Read the Docs
Project Home
Builds
Free document hosting provided by
Read the Docs
.